1. Nicodemus name meaning and origin

The name Nicodemus boasts a rich and fascinating history that traces back to ancient Greece. Its Greek roots lie in the word 'Nikodemos' (Νικόδημος), a name that artfully blends two significant elements: 'nike,' which translates to 'victory,' and 'demos,' meaning 'people' or 'population.' This combination lends the name a powerful meaning—essentially, it can be interpreted as 'victory of the people' or 'conqueror of the people.' Such a name not only embodies the ideals of triumph and success but also reflects the values of leadership and community that were held in high esteem in classical Greek society. Names during this period were often chosen for their meanings, with parents seeking to instill strength and virtue in their children through the names they carried. The legacy of Nicodemus invites us to explore themes of victory and the role of individuals in shaping the course of human affairs, a narrative that resonates even today.

Historically, Nicodemus stands out in the New Testament, where he is portrayed as a Pharisee and a member of the Jewish Sanhedrin who sought a clandestine meeting with Jesus under the cover of night. This encounter speaks volumes, not only about Nicodemus's curiosity and desire for understanding but also about the complexities of faith and societal norms during that era. His actions, which included assisting in the burial preparations for Jesus, have cemented his place in Christian tradition, particularly within Orthodox and Catholic circles. This biblical connection has played a significant role in the name's durability throughout history, allowing it to transcend the ages. While it has not surged in popularity in English-speaking regions, the name Nicodemus has sustained a noteworthy presence, reminding us of its deep historical roots and religious significance that continue to inspire individuals seeking names with profound meanings.

3. Variations and nicknames of Nicodemus

The evolution of the name Nicodemus has been a remarkable journey through various cultures and languages over the centuries. Initially emerging in its Greek form as 'Nikodemos' (Νικόδημος), early Christians adopted the name, honoring the biblical figure who sought wisdom from Jesus at night. As the name traversed through Europe, it began to take on diverse forms, adapting to the linguistic nuances of different regions. In Latin texts, it remained relatively unchanged as 'Nicodemus,' while Eastern Orthodox communities embraced 'Nikodim.' Italian speakers often refer to it as 'Nicodemo,' and in Spanish-speaking areas, variations such as 'Nicodemo' or 'Nicomedo' are common. The French adaptation is 'Nicodème,' while in German-speaking countries, the name appears as 'Nikodemus.' Slavic cultures have their own renditions, typically using 'Nikodem' or 'Nikodim.' Additionally, the Hebrew variant 'Nakdimon' highlights the name's diverse linguistic journey, showcasing how a single name can embody a tapestry of cultural significance and historical narrative as it weaves through time and geography.

Beyond formal variants, Nicodemus has spawned numerous affectionate nicknames and diminutives. The most common English nicknames include Nico, Nick, and Nicky, offering simpler alternatives to the formal four-syllable name. Some families use Deem or Demus, derived from the latter portion of the name. In Italian communities, Nico or Niko prevail as popular shortenings, while Nikki serves as a unisex option in many cultures. More creative or uncommon nicknames include Code, Cody, and even Nim. Among Eastern European families, Niko and Nikola function as both standalone names and Nicodemus diminutives. Children bearing this distinguished name might also respond to playful forms like Nicky-D or Dimi, particularly in informal settings. These varied short forms allow the name's bearer to maintain formal dignity while enjoying approachable alternatives across different stages of life and social contexts.
